About the role

The Housing Solutions service has a new and exciting role within the Assessment & Prevention team.

As Refugee Housing Adviser you will work closely with the Council's Refugee Outreach Team to carry out early intervention to ensure that asylum seekers in NASS accommodation and refugees who have recently gained status have access to housing advice and support. You will manage your own case load of asylum seekers/refugees and other homeless applicants to assess their housing needs. You will offer housing advice to prevent homelessness and support clients to access a broad range of housing options.

The key responsibilities are:

Provide housing advice and support to prevent and resolve homelessness among asylum seekers and refugees who are homeless or at risk of becoming homeless. Be the main point of contact between the Refugee Outreach Team and the Housing Solution Team, as well as the Home Office and National Asylum Seekers Service (NASS).  Identify and assess support needs and refer to relevant housing pathways and support services. Develop and implement new processes in coordination with Refugee Outreach Team to ensure early intervention prior to the end of NASS support to prevent homelessness. Assess, administer and make decisions on the outcome of individual homelessness applications under Part VII of the Housing Act 1996 (as amended) in accordance with legislation and case law.  Maintain high levels of excellent customer care and empathy throughout.
